Market Pain Points & Challenges
Customers deploying equipment for Auto Factory Tour consistently report that reliability is their number one concern. Audio dropouts during critical moments—like when a guide explains the intricacies of a hybrid engine or the history of a classic model—can completely derail the narrative. In a factory setting, concrete walls, metal structures, and heavy machinery can interfere with wireless signals, making robust connectivity a non-negotiable feature. Bulky devices that irritate visitors, especially when worn for tours lasting over an hour, create friction that undermines the entire experience. A heavy or poorly designed receiver can distract a guest from the tour content, turning a positive impression into a negative one.
Complex setup procedures further compound these challenges. In a busy Auto Factory Tour operation where multiple groups may be starting simultaneously, guides need equipment that is ready to go instantly. Systems that require pairing, channel selection, or battery checks before each tour create bottlenecks and increase the risk of human error. The pain point is clear: tour operators need a solution that is as reliable as the cars they showcase, with a user experience that is as intuitive as a modern dashboard. Technical Specification Comparison
A specification comparison of the RC8860, RC2408, and RC085 for Auto Factory Tour reveals clear differentiation points that guide purchasing decisions. The RC8860, at just 59 grams, is the lightest of the three—a critical advantage for tours where visitors wear the receiver for extended periods. Its design, originally engineered for equestrian training, prioritizes freedom of movement and comfort, making it ideal for factory tours that involve walking long distances or climbing stairs. In contrast, the RC2408, weighing 70 grams, focuses on extended range. This model is the best choice for large factory venues where guides need to address groups spread across wide assembly halls or outdoor test tracks. Its heavier weight is a trade-off for a more powerful transmitter that maintains signal integrity over greater distances.
The RC085 sits in a middle ground at 62 grams, adding a clear LCD display that provides immediate visual feedback on channel, battery level, and signal strength. This feature is invaluable in complex factory environments where multiple tour groups operate simultaneously, as it allows guides to quickly verify they are on the correct channel. The following table summarizes the key specifications for direct comparison:
| Model | Position | Weight | Key Advantage for Auto Factory Tour |
|---|---|---|---|
| RC8860 | High-motion, comfort-focused guiding | 59 g | Ultra-lightweight for long-duration tours |
| RC2408 | Long-range, large venue guiding | 70 g | Extended range for vast factory spaces |
| RC085 | Multi-group, display-guided operation | 62 g | LCD display for channel and battery status |
The right choice depends on matching these engineering trade-offs to your specific use case priorities. For a tour focused on the final assembly line, where visitors are stationary for long periods, the comfort of the RC8860 is paramount. For a tour that spans the entire factory floor—from the paint shop to the test track—the range of the RC2408 ensures no guest misses a word. For operations running multiple concurrent tours, the visual clarity of the RC085 display prevents channel conflicts and reduces guide error.
